Komen Appoints Oakmont Resident to Pittsburgh Board

Mark Schneider was selected to join the board of directors for the Pittsburgh Affiliate of Susan G. Komen for the Cure.

An Oakmont resident was recently appointed to the board of directors of the Pittsburgh Affiliate of Susan G. Komen for the Cure for the 2013-2014 fiscal year.

Mark Schneider is director of finance for Heritage Valley Health System

He is a graduate of Duquesne University and received his Certified Public Accountant (CPA) license in 1991. Schneider was awarded the Certified Healthcare Financial Professional (CHFP) designation in 2005.
